Clean Heat for All: Packaged Terminal Heat Pump Program - Phase II

The program seeks to accelerate the adoption of cold climate, high-efficiency packaged window heat pumps (PWHPs) as a minimally invasive electrification solution for existing multifamily buildings across New York State. It operates in two phases: Phase I establishes eligibility by requiring manufacturers and vendors to submit documentation proving their PWHPs meet NYSERDA’s technical and performance specifications; approved applicants become Program Participants but receive no funding at this stage. Phase II opens exclusively to these qualified Participants, offering performance-based incentives to install PWHPs in five-unit or greater multifamily buildings, including rentals, cooperatives, and condominiums. Incentives are structured as 50% of equipment costs up to $1,500 per unit for market-rate sites and 75% up to $2,250 per unit for low- and moderate-income sites, with a maximum of $500,000 per demonstration site and a lifetime cap of $2,000,000 per PWHP brand. All installations must adhere to NYSERDA-mandated performance monitoring plans designed to track real-world efficiency and reliability. The program runs until June 30, 2027, with no set-asides for minority, women-owned, service-disabled veteran-owned, or disadvantaged businesses, and is open to all counties in New York State.
